No. I mean OPIC - Overseas Private Investment Corporation. It is a
federal agency that makes loans to private companies so they can embark
on business ventures without risking their own capital. It is better
known as the federal corporate welfare program, which BushCo. has
expanded mightily into various oil companies. And before somebody
